Yining Zhang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Yining Zhang has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 523 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 4 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Yining Zhang's work include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(4 papers),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(2 papers) and Innovation Diffusion and Forecasting (2 papers). Yining Zhang is often cited by papers focused on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(4 papers), Energy, Environment, Economic Growth (2 papers) and Innovation Diffusion and Forecasting (2 papers). Yining Zhang collaborates with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Yining Zhang's co-authors include Hyun Jung Park, Haijun Wang, Jun Ma, Jie‐Yun Song, Shuo Wang, Yide Yang, Liangrong Song, Yiran Niu, Zhifeng Chen and Lu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and PLoS ONE.
